About the Journal

Pinnacle Academic Press Proceedings Series (PAPPS) is an international, refereed, double-blind peer-reviewed, open-access journal that compiles the proceedings of academic conferences, workshops, and symposia across various disciplines. The series highlights groundbreaking research, emerging trends, and innovations presented by scholars, researchers, and practitioners in their respective fields. With a focus on high-quality contributions, the series serves as a valuable resource for the academic community, facilitating the dissemination of knowledge, fostering collaboration, and offering insights into the latest developments in science, technology, and academia.
